The American Bakers Association (ABA) is pleased to welcome five new members to their Board of Directors.

Trina Bediako is the newly appointed CEO of New Horizons Baking Company with nearly two decades of experience at the enterprise. New Horizons Baking Company serves more than 2,000 quick service restaurants across Ohio, Kentucky, Indiana, Michigan, and Western Pennsylvania as well as national retail and sandwich makers.

Chuck Metzger, CEO, of Hearthside Foods brings to ABA’s Board more than 30 years of executive leadership in global food companies including Kraft and Coca-Cola. Hearthside Foods is a leading contract manufacturer and the largest private bakery in the U.S.

Tim Smith, VP/GM Snacking at TreeHouse Foods is a results-oriented business leader with an 18-year track record driving growth for leading brands within top tier CPG and early-stage start-ups such as Blue Apron, Tyson Foods, Hillshire Brands, and General Mills.

George Vindiola is the vice president of research and development at Campbell’s newly-created snack unit. Vindiola’s technical expertise has resulted in several patents and a string of successes at companies such as Frito Lay, PepsiCo, and Pepperidge Farm.

Tyson Yu, ARYTZA North America’s CEO, joins ABA’s Board touting 10 years at the international baking company in addition to previous strategy and investment positions at Fresh Start Bakeries, Lindsay Goldberg, and Merrill Lynch.

“We are honored to welcome these five accomplished leaders to the ABA Board of Directors and look forward to their diverse insights and leadership. These new Board leaders also ensures that ABA truly represents all segments of the baking industry. As these leaders join the ABA leadership, I also want to recognize the unwavering service of outgoing Board member and past ABA Chair Rich Scalise,” said Robb MacKie, president and CEO, ABA. “Rich has served on the board for the past 14 years and as ABA Chair where he steered both our organization and our industry in a positive direction. ABA’s Members and staff are grateful for his significant contributions.
